Aside from its aesthetic appeal it is necessary to consider the functionality of the coop. It must hold firmly feeds and water catcher. If coop are for layers then consider making some strategic design to care for eggs and newly hatched chicks. Eggs should be caught by firm yet soft materials and let it roll to the basket. Another thing you must should the portability of the coop. What if it rains hard? Hence coop can be portable to protect the chicken against the unfavorable weather outside. Make sure that your coop is large enough to allow your birds to live in comfort as happy birds will lay more regularly be more rewarding and easier to maintain. Some chicken coop plans will also incorporate a nesting area to the outside of the coop where eggs will be easily collected.
